when you start your braclet or necklace, put a bead inthe middle of your two starting strings and then tie a knot under it so you're working with 4. understand? I hope so. Then at the end of your piece, use 1 string to wrap around the others until you have a long enough thread to loop, tie a knot and you have a perfect loop to put the bead on the other end into to fasten. It works as a great ending knot and a great way to fasten your jewlery.
